Breguet |
The Société des
Ateliers d'Aviation Louis Breguet also known as Breguet Aviation
was a French aircraft manufacturer. The company was set up in
1911 by aviation pioneer Louis Charles Breguet. The company,
together with the British Aircraft Corporation, was a parent
to SEPECAT which was formed to develop and produce the SEPECAT
Jaguar aircraft. In 1971 it merged with Dassault to form Avions
Marcel Dassault-Breguet Aviation. |
